The Dojo of Ascetic Training: Traversing the 16 Sacred Temples of Kochi.

Kochi Prefecture, traditionally known as “Tosa-no-Kuni,” represents the stage of endurance and inner strength. This category documents the journey from Temple No. 24 (Hotsumisaki-ji) at the tip of Cape Muroto to Temple No. 39 (Enkou-ji) near the border of Ehime.

Often called the most challenging part of the pilgrimage due to the vast distances between temples, the Kochi section offers breathtaking views of the Pacific Ocean and profound moments of solitude. Whether you are navigating the rugged cliffs of Cape Muroto or the serene paths of Cape Ashizuri, these articles capture the physical and mental resilience required to complete this “Dojo of Ascetic Training.”
